- 1Box Plots2 marks
A box plot has a minimum of 13 and a maximum of 67. Work out the range.
- 2Indices2 marks
Write 6^6 x 6^3 as a single power of 6.
- 3Sequences (Nth Term)3 marks
Work out the nth term of the sequence 3, 6, 9, 12, ...
- 4Ratio2 marks
Red and blue raffle tickets are in the ratio 5 : 7. There are 65 red raffle tickets. How many raffle tickets are there altogether?
- 5Cylinders2 marks
A cylinder has radius 7 cm and height 16 cm. Work out its curved surface area, to 1 decimal place.
